Mike Andersen has been pursuing his career for 20 years with consistency and elegance. A Danish national, his work is distinguished by its quality and its instinct for constant renewal. Each of his nine albums adopts a different aesthetic approach from his predecessors, while remaining faithful to the American music that constitutes his cultural background.

Mike's repertoire is modern, sometimes verging on pop. The tracks on his latest album, "Raise Your Hand", are essentially mid-tempo and acoustic, with flashes of electric guitar, haunted backing vocals and diaphanous keyboards. But Mike Andersen has no neurasthenic sadness.  His favorite themes - betrayal, regrets, the thirst for freedom - are carried by compositions that move halfway between blues, folk and gothic country, allowing themselves a few successful escapes into swamp rock or rhythm & blues territory. Perfectly interpreted by musicians who have followed him devoutly for the past 10 years, both on stage and in the studio, this recent album unfurls a chiaroscuro charm that is profoundly authentic, and proves a little more endearing with each listen.

Jens Kristian Dam (Drums), Kristian Kold (Bass), Kristian Fogh (Keys and vocals), Johannes Nørrelykke (Guitar and vocals), Mike Andersen (Vocals and Guitar)
